Nursing theory expresses the values and beliefs of the discipline, creating a structure to organize knowledge and illuminate nursing practice. Nursing Theoretical Works The nursing theory describes, predicts and explains the nursing phenomenon. Nursing theory consists of a collection of conclusions about real events and conditions that may be applied to real world nursing situations. Importance of nursing theories Nursing theory aims to describe, predict and explain the phenomenon of nursing (Chinn and Jacobs1978). The nursing theory era, coupled with an awareness of nursing as a profession and as an academic discipline in its own right, emerged from debates and discussions in the 1960s regarding the proper direction and appropriate discipline for nursing knowledge development. Nursing theory assists with defining and constructing the framework upon which nursing practice is developed. The Importance of Nursing Theory for Nurse Education Prior to the development of nursing theories, nursing was seen as a task-oriented occupation, and nurses were trained by doctors.
